Онлайн-обучение
Курсы разработки приложений для платформы Android
Ближайшая дата: удобная для вас
Расписание: удобное для вас
Место по согласованию: онлайн, в наших классах, на территории слушателя или преподавателя.
1 ак. час = 45 минут
По результатам консультации специалиста контакт-центра, сможете определиться с оптимальным количеством занятий, необходимым для достижения вашей цели
Курсы разработки приложений для платформы Android
720.00 руб.
900.00 руб.
12 BYN стоимость за ак час
60 часов (1 ак. час = 45 минут)
В среднем в группе: 7 человек
900.00 руб.
720.00 руб.
12 BYN стоимость за ак час
Записаться
Возможность записаться и прослушать данный курс в Витебске позволяет в максимально короткие сроки ознакомиться со всеми принципами и особенностями создания приложений на платформе Android и применять их на практике.
Цели курса:
- Научиться создавать качественные и уникальные приложения, работающие на данной платформе;
- Научиться управлять всеми дополнительными модулями и плагинами;
- Научиться выявлять и решать основные ошибки в работе приложений, а так же публиковать их после тестирования, в сети интернет.
Задачи курса:
- Обучение всем основным принципам и понятием корректного программирования, с использованием языка Java;
- Освоение и изучение основного жизненного цикла платформы Android;
- Научиться самостоятельно, обрабатывать все полученные данные и информацию.
В результате представленной учебной программы, учащиеся приобретут:
- знание основных принципов и понятий, для того чтобы самостоятельно программировать на Java;
- устанавливать и настраивать среду программирования;
- знать основные виды приложений и их структуру;
- умение работать, с базами данных, данной платформы;
- создание многооконного приложения;
- использовать библиотеки;
- возможность, использовать все возможности созданного приложения, с помощью смартфона.
Документы после прохождения курсов
По окончании курсов «Лидер» наши курсанты получают бесплатно сертификата об обучении

Дополнительно вы можете приобрести:
1. Сертификат на английском языке, который подтверждает прохождение обучения в случае отъезда за границу. Стоимость данного документа составляет 14 рублей.

2. Свидетельство в твердой обложке с указанием количества пройденных учебных часов по темам обучения. Стоимость данного документа составляет 15 рублей.

.
.
.
При приобретении 2-х документов (сертификат на английском языке и свидетельство), стоимость составит 20 рублей.
В образовательный центр “Лидер” постоянно поступают заявки от работодателей, желающих принять на работу выпускников курсов, вместе с тем мы не можем гарантировать трудоустройство выпускникам.
Записаться на курсы и узнать подробную информацию можно по телефону: 375 (44) 7-352-352.
«Сильные стороны» курсов «Лидер»
1. У нас работают преподаватели с огромным практическим опытом, умением быстро найти подход к учащемуся и подобрать самую эффективную учебную программу, сочетающую в себе теорию с практикой.
2. Наш курс дает все необходимые навыки и знания для того, чтобы Вы смогли справиться со многими поставленными задачами. Вы самостоятельно сможете выбирать, в каком направлении развиваться дальше и как строить свою будущую карьеру.
3. У нас Вы можете выбирать наиболее удобный график обучения, а также подходящий вам уровень сложности программы для того, чтобы сочетать курсы с работой, быстро и качественно получить необходимые знания.
4. По окончании курсов мы выдаем своим выпускникам документы, повышающие вашу ценность в глазах работодателя, которые помогут вам устроиться на новую, интересную и доходную работу.
5. У нас очень демократичная цена на курсы!
6. Наши классы оснащены современным оборудованием с персональным компьютером для каждого учащегося.
Онлайн-обучение
Курсы разработки приложений для платформы Android
Ближайшая дата: удобная для вас
Расписание: удобное для вас
Место по согласованию: онлайн, в наших классах, на территории слушателя или преподавателя.
1 ак. час = 45 минут
По результатам консультации специалиста контакт-центра, сможете определиться с оптимальным количеством занятий, необходимым для достижения вашей цели
Курсы разработки приложений для платформы Android
720.00 руб.
900.00 руб.
12 BYN стоимость за ак час
60 часов (1 ак. час = 45 минут)
В среднем в группе: 7 человек
900.00 руб.
720.00 руб.
12 BYN стоимость за ак час
Записаться
Кол-во человек в группе — 6-10
Проводится набор в группы — утренние, дневные, вечерние, выходного дня
Программа обучения:
-
- Основы программирования на Java;
- Платформа Android. Приложения для Android. Android Market. Публикация приложений;
- Установка и настройка среды программирования ADT Bundle;
- Виды приложений и их структура;
- Основные этапы разработки приложения с использованием Android IDE;
- Основы разработки интерфейсов мобильных приложений;
- Основы разработки многооконных приложений;
- Создание многоэкранного приложения;
- Использование возможностей смартфона в приложениях;
- Многооконное приложение;
- Геолокационные возможности;
- Использование библиотек;
- Работа с базами данных, графикой и анимацией. Разработка игр;
- Работа с базами данных в Android;
- Новое поколение инструментальных средств разработки мобильных HTML5-приложений. Intel XDK;
- Установка и настройка среды программирования Intel XDK. Создание первых приложений.
Индивидуальное обучение. Продолжительность 16-32 ак.ч.
1. Начало работы с Android
- Введение. Установка Android Studio и Android SDK
- Первый проект в Android Studio
- Создание графического интерфейса
2. Основы создания интерфейса
- Создание интерфейса в коде java
- Определение интерфейса в файле XML. Файлы layout
- Определение размеров
- Ширина и высота элементов
- Внутренние и внешние отступы
- ConstraintLayout
- Размеры элементов в ConstraintLayout
- Цепочки элементов в ConstraintLayout
- Программное создание ConstraintLayout и позиционионирование
- LinearLayout
- RelativeLayout
- TableLayout
- FrameLayout
- GridLayout
- ScrollView
- Gravity и позиционирование внутри элемента
- Вложенные layout
3. Основные элементы управления
- TextView
- EditText
- Button
- Приложение Калькулятор
- Всплывающие окна. Toast
- Snackbar
- Checkbox
- ToggleButton
- RadioButton
- DatePicker
- TimePicker
- Ползунок SeekBar
4. Ресурсы
- Работа с ресурсами
- Ресурсы строк
- Ресурсы dimension
- Ресурсы Color и установка цвета
5. Activity
- Activity и жизненный цикл приложения
- Файл манифеста AndroidManifest.xml
- Введение в Intent. Запуск Activity
- Передача данных между Activity. Сериализация
- Parcelable
- Получение результата из Activity
- Взаимодействие между Activity
6. Работа с изображениями
- Ресурсы изображений
- ImageView
- Изображения из папки assets
7. Адаптеры и списки
- ListView и ArrayAdapter
- Ресурс string-array и ListView
- Выбор элемента в ListView
- Добавление и удаление в ArrayAdapter и ListView
- Расширение списков и создание адаптера
- Оптимизация адаптера и View Holder
- Сложный список с кнопками
- ListActivity
- Выпадающий список Spinner
- Виджет автодополнения AutoCompleteTextView
- GridView
- RecyclerView
- Обработка выбора элемента в RecyclerView
8. Стили и темы
- Стили
- Темы
9. Меню
- Создание меню
- Группы в меню и подменю
10. Фрагменты
- Введение во фрагменты
- Жизненный цикл фрагментов
- Взаимодействие между фрагментами
- Фрагменты в альбомном и портретном режиме
11. Многопоточность
- Создание потоков и визуальный интерфейс
- Потоки, фрагменты и ViewModel
- Класс AsyncTask
- AsyncTask и фрагменты
12. Работа с сетью. WebView
- WebView
- Загрузка данных и класс HttpURLConnection
13. Работа с мультимедиа
- Работа с видео
- Воспроизведение аудио
14. Настройки и состояние приложения
- Сохранение состояния приложения
- Создание и получение настроек SharedPreferences
- PreferenceFragmentCompat
15. Работа с файловой системой
- Чтение и сохранение файлов
- Размещение файлов во внешнем хранилище
16. Работа с базами данных SQLite
- Подключение к базе данных SQLite
- SQLiteOpenHelper и SimpleCursorAdapter, получение данных из SQLite
- Добавление, удаление и обновление данных в SQLite
- Использование существующей БД SQLite
- Динамический поиск по базе данных SQLite
- Модель, репозиторий и работа с базой данных
17. Перелистывание страниц и ViewPager2
- ViewPager2 и разделение приложения на страницы
- Заголовки страниц и TabLayout